Overview of Wheel Digger

The Wheel Digger is an all around hydraulic machine designed to be used in very difficult soil conditions and for performing functions such as excavation and trenching. The wheels on this machine can operate on all types of terrain and will give you maximum mobility. The bucket and backhoe arm combination allows you to dig accurately and remove debris with as little impact as possible on your surroundings. It is designed to provide the operator with a high level of productivity and comfort, as well as safety and reliability, and can be used on a daily basis for many years.

Advantages of Wheel Digger

Compact Maneuverability

Wheel Diggers are built to work in small areas with minimal footprint so their size allows them access to a wide variety of different worksite conditions while providing an outstanding turning radius which allows for easy navigation of crowded worksites. They provide low cost operations, maintain structure integrity and allow for excavation, loading and trenching without sacrificing safety or accuracy.

Powerful Digging

A powerful hydraulic system gives the Wheel Digger a high breakout force and very smooth operation. The adjustable backhoe and precision bucket enable the Wheel Digger to perform trenching, material handling and grading operations very quickly and with less manual labor.

All-Terrain Mobility

With all-terrain wheels plus an optional tracked conversion, the Wheel Digger has traction on soft (i.e., soil, mud), temperate (rocky) and hard (cement) terrain. The Wheel Digger also has a suspended chassis that helps absorb vibration; as well as, all four (4) wheels turning together to help with alignment and reduce operator fatigue when working on job sites.

Operator-Centric Design

Creating a productive workspace through an ergonomic cockpit design, easily understandable controls, and adjustable seating will help keep employees comfortable. Having clear sight lines through the cockpit and utilizing responsive joysticks with hydraulic controls will both relieve strain on the employee's body as well as provide an integrated diagnostic system and maintenance reminders to maintain uptime and safer work shifts.

What maintenance is required for Wheel Digger?

To keep hydraulic systems functioning properly, aligned tracks or wheels, and maintain the mechanical and hydraulic safety systems, regular inspections, maintenance (including lubrication), and schedule filter changes must be performed in accordance with the service schedule. Routine checks should be scheduled after heavy use or in severe working conditions.
